Elements to Think about



Consider the climate of your camping destination when picking a weather-resistant camping tent. If you're heading to an area with uncertain weather patterns, like mountainous areas or seaside locations, opt for a tent that can endure solid winds and abrupt rain showers. Seek functions such as enhanced seams, water-proof materials, and a durable framework to ensure your shelter can hold up versus the aspects.



Additionally, think of the season you'll be camping in. For summer season adventures, concentrate on tents with sufficient air flow to prevent stodginess and getting too hot. Fit together panels and home windows are terrific for promoting air flow while maintaining bugs out.

On the other hand, for winter camping, prioritize camping tents with great insulation to catch warmth inside. A rainfly that extends close to the ground can also aid shield you from cool drafts and snow.

Tent Materials and Construction



When picking a weather-resistant camping tent for camping, pay attention to the materials used and the building of the camping tent to guarantee toughness and protection against the elements. Search for outdoors tents made from high-grade, water-proof products like ripstop nylon or polyester with a durable water repellent (DWR) finish. These products aren't just lightweight but additionally supply outstanding protection versus rainfall and moisture.

Additionally, take a look at the building and construction of the tent. Picking the Right Size



Selecting the proper size for your tent is crucial for a comfortable outdoor camping experience. When choosing a camping tent, consider the amount of individuals will certainly be using it and the gear you need to save within. A great rule of thumb is to size up if you're uncertain.

A larger camping tent offers additional space to walk around and store valuables, enhancing convenience during your camping journey.

For solo campers, a one-person camping tent is light-weight and very easy to establish, excellent for backpacking experiences. If you're camping with a companion, think about a two-person tent for a snug fit or go with a three-person tent for more space. Family members or groups need to consider larger options such as four-person or six-person camping tents to suit everyone conveniently.

Furthermore, remember the outdoor tents's peak elevation and floor dimensions. Taller individuals might like a camping tent with a greater optimal elevation for easier motion inside. Inspect the flooring measurements to guarantee there's enough room for sleeping and storing gear without feeling cramped.
